Section 140
of Labuan Islamic Financial Services and Securities Act 2010
Section 140
No member, officer, servant or agent of the Syariah
Supervisory Council or person who has by any means access to any record, book, register, correspondence, document, material or information, relating to the business and affairs of the Syariah
Supervisory Council in the performance of his duties or the exercise of his functions, shall give, divulge, reveal, publish or otherwise disclose to any person such record, book, register, correspondence, document, material or information unless he is lawfully required to do so by any court or under any written law.
(2)
Any person who contravenes subsection (1) shall be guilty of an offence and shall, on conviction, be liable to a fine not exceeding five hundred thousand ringgit or to imprisonment for a term not exceeding one year or to both.
